- [ ] Step 7: Archive cold storage buckets (Glacierline tier). Confirm both ceremony witnesses are present, verify bucket manifests match the Oxbow ledger, then seal the archive key shares. Plugin authors may observe but not handle shares. Once sealed, the archive index itself is encrypted and can only be reopened with the passphrase below.

vault phrase of badup-hahig = tamael-aldael-kelmir-istael-fenok-istwyn-tamius-jorath-oliion

Release item — Monthly partitioning, Vellum ledger tables. Pre-flight: confirm partitions exist through month+3; the creation job must never lag inside a release window. Verify the router function handles rows dated before the first partition — they go to the catch-all, not an error. Check that the retention sweep only detaches, never drops, without the release manager's sign-off. Query plans for the top five reports must show partition pruning. All checks green in staging as of this morning. The verified build is stamped with the token below.

session token of bahip-hawep = htk4_b0c1

Ticket #— Floor 9 Opening Prep, Brindlemoor House

Hi facilities folks, Floor 9 opens to staff next Monday and we need a few things squared away before then. Lift access is live, but the two side doors by the kitchenette are still on the old lock config — please reprogram them before Friday. Also, signage for the quiet rooms hasn't arrived, so pop up the temporary printed ones for now. Until the badge readers sync, the interim door code for Floor 9 is below.

door code, bajop-bajog: bdg-DSWAC-43621

**Q: Why does the Pellgrove autocomplete widget debounce at 250ms instead of per-keystroke?**

The debounce protects the geocoding backend from burst traffic and keeps suggestion ordering stable while users type. Reviewers should reject changes that lower this value without a load-test attached. Note also that the widget normalizes diacritics client-side, so server-side matching assumes pre-normalized input. The performance budget and review checklist are maintained internally here.

wiki page, tahaf-tajog: https://jira.ordindyn.corp/pipeline